#E8BE17 Color
#E8BE17 is rgb(232, 190, 23) in RGB, hsl(48, 82%, 50%) in HSL, and about cmyk(0%, 18%, 90%, 9%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Deep Lemon (#F5C71A), very hard to tell apart at ΔE 4.63. Black text is the more readable choice on this background.

#E8BE17 Channel Values
How #E8BE17 bre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 232 · G 190 · B 23 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 48° · S 82% · L 50%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 48° · S 90% · V 91%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 0% · M 18% · Y 90% · K 9%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 1.78:1 vs white · 11.81: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|
Text Contrast & Accessibility
W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#E8BE17 background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

#E8BE17 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#E8BE17?
#E8BE17 is a mid-tone yellow — rgb(232, 190, 23) in RGB and hsl(48, 82%, 50%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Deep Lemon (#F5C71A), which is very hard to tell apart at a CIE76 distance of 4.63.
What is the RGB value of #E8BE17?
#E8BE17 is rgb(232, 190, 23) — red 232, green 190, and blue 23 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#E8BE17?
#E8BE17 converts to approximately cmyk(0%, 18%, 90%, 9%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#E8BE17 be black or white?
Black text is the more readable choice. #E8BE17 scores 1.78:1 against white and 11.81: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#E8BE17 as a CSS color keyword?
No. #E8BE17 is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is gold (#FFD700) at a CIE76 distance of 13.02, which is visibly different.
